The Graduate Certificate in Clinical Dermatology and Aesthetics is a postgraduate program designed to equip students with the knowledge and skills required to work in the field of clinical dermatology and aesthetics.
This program is ideal for individuals who have a strong interest in skin health and beauty, and wish to pursue a career in this field.
Upon completion of the program, students will have gained a comprehensive understanding of clinical dermatology and aesthetics, including the diagnosis and treatment of skin conditions, as well as the principles of cosmetic procedures.
The learning outcomes of this program include the ability to assess and manage skin conditions, prescribe topical and systemic treatments, and perform cosmetic procedures such as Botox and fillers.
The duration of the Graduate Certificate in Clinical Dermatology and Aesthetics is typically one year, with students completing a series of coursework and clinical placements.
